Astral Media Mentorship Award Winner: Bobie Taffe
Women in Film & Television – Toronto (WIFT-T), is pleased to announce Bobie Taffe as the winner of the Astral Media Mentorship Award.
The Astral Media Mentorship Award is a national competitive program that gives one talented Canadian female or male producer who is a visible minority, Aboriginal or is disabled, the invaluable opportunity to prepare for the 2009 Banff World Television Festival through a festival bursary and an intensive five day pre-festival mentorship with WIFT-T, other industry experts, and an Astral Media executive.
The Astral Media Mentorship Awards is presented in partnership with Astral Media.

WIFT-T Announces the WIFT-T Development Incubator Participants
Women in Film & Television - Toronto (WIFT-T) is pleased to announce the 2009 WIFT-T Development Incubator participants. This initiative gives five writer/producer teams the opportunity to work with script consultants and select industry advisors to develop their feature length dramatic projects.
The WIFT-T Development Incubator is designed to develop market-driven feature films and support the next generation of Canadian feature film professionals.
"People from across the country submit applications for the WIFT-T Development Incubator," said Sadia Zaman, Executive Director of WIFT-T. “The opportunity to work on a feature script in such a focused, collaborative environment is unique, and we’re thrilled to be able to offer this opportunity for this year’s talented group. Many of the participants from the program also move on to the next critical creative stage, and their work gets noticed. Congratulations to this year’s participants.”
The WIFT-T Development Incubator is presented with support from the Bata Shoe Museum, Ontario Media Development Corporation & Telefilm Canada.

Kodak New Vision Mentorship Award
Women in Film & Television - Toronto (WIFT-T) is pleased to announce a call for applications for the Kodak New Vision Mentorship Award. The Kodak New Vision Mentorship Award provides one Canadian female director with the opportunity to prepare for the 2009 Toronto International Film Festival through intensive industry coaching and a post-festival creative mentorship.

WIFT-T Business Management for
Media Professionals Program
The WIFT-T Business Management for Media Professionals Program is a compilation of six modules, each consisting of three Saturday sessions. It is recommended for working professionals with up to three years experience in the industry, related university or college training and for those transitioning to a new area of the business.
This certificate program is presented in partnership with Canwest.

CFC Media Lab Telus Interactive Art & Entertainment Program
Application Deadline | June 19, 2009
The TELUS Interactive Art & Entertainment Program (IAEP) is a five-month, post-graduate residency that merges collaborative exploration with the fundamentals of new media, with a particular emphasis on narrative theory and storytelling. Team-based, self-directed and project-driven, the TELUS IAEP focuses on creating inventive interactive narrative projects for the Canadian and international marketplace.

New York Women in Film & Television/Hamptons International Film Festival
WIFT-T members are invited to participate in the New York Women in Film & Television/Hamptons International Film Festival short series, To The Point: Women Telling Stories Through Media.
The Series provides a unique platform for WIFT members to showcase their talents in areas of shorts, composed fictional narratives, animation, documentaries, and experimental films that bring an unorthodox and original perspective to the experiences of women from all walks of life from around the world.
There is no fee to submit, films must be under 20 minutes and completed between June 30, 2006 to June 30, 2009.
